Sgt. James Macneil, of Glace Bay, N.S., died Monday morning near the village of Nakhonay, about 20 kilometres southwest of Kandahar city. june21 2010
The 28-year-old was killed after dismounting from his armoured vehicle. Macneil was from the 2 Combat Engineer Regiment based at CFB Petawawa. He was serving with the 1st Battalion, The Royal Canadian Regiment Battle Group.
